aid: philadelphia-inquirer name: The Philadelphia Inquirer description: >- The Philadelphia Inquirer is the largest newspaper in Pennsylvania, owned by the nonprofit Lenfest Institute for Journalism. Inquirer.com publishes Philadelphia, regional, national, and world news, sports, business, opinion, arts, food, and obituaries. The Inquirer does not operate a public commercial developer program.
